Muni delivers ‘Kadve Pravachan’ in Haryana Vidhan Sabha

Chandigarh, Aug 26 (PTI) Preacher Muni Tarun SagarMaharaj today delivered ‘Kadve Pravachan’ at the Vidhan SabhaComplex here in which he laid stress on improving sex ratioand eliminating corruption in the country. After the first day of the monsoon session of HaryanaVidhan Sabha was adjourned, Maharaj delivered his addresswhich was attended by Haryana Governor Kaptan Singh Solanki,members of the House as well as bureaucrats. While thanking Khattar government for inviting him in theHouse, he touched upon various issues in his talk, includingthe skewed sex ratio in the country. "As per government survey, there are 990 females against1000 males in the country and in this situation 10 male willhave to stay unmarried," he said, adding it was a disturbingsituation. While giving suggestions for improving sex ratio inthe country, Maharaj said at the political level those whohave girl child should be given priority in contesting polls. "At social level, people should not marry their girlsin those families where there is no girl child," he said,adding, "if we follow these suggestions, we will get goodresults on improving sex ratio." He also described corruption as the biggest problem ofthe country. "A survey says that every third person in the country iscorrupt and 60 per cent are on the verge of being corruptwhile there are only 10 percent people who are honest," hesaid. He claimed if corruption is eliminated in the country, itcan fast turn into a developed nation. He said Opposition of the government is "justifiedif it is meant to wake it up from slumber". Haryana Education Minister Ram Bilas Sharma had yesterdaysaid the address by Maharaj was unanimously decided in an allparty meeting held recently in Haryana Niwas. PTI CHS VJ AQSRGAQS
